Scalloway Junior High School sits at the edge of the village of Scalloway in the Shetland Islands. It overlooks a busy, modern harbour which is sheltered from the Atlantic by a plethora of islands and tiny skerries.

The school is a combined nursery, primary, and secondary at present and delivers education to 246 pupils aged from 3-16 years old. The catchment area is rural, widespread, and diverse. Children attending the school generally live in the village itself, on neighbouring islands, small settlements, and in isolated dwellings by the sea or inland.

The values of this traditional Shetland community are also the values that the school promotes. This is a community that values resilience, diversity, citizenship, identity and sustainability, and looks to the school to equip young people with these qualities.

Scalloway Junior High School is a school at the heart of its community and the community is at the heart of the school.
